Factors That Affect Your Scrap Car Price

Vehicle Condition
We buy cars in any condition: running, damaged, or completely non-functional. Vehicles with reusable parts or an intact catalytic converter usually earn higher offers, but we’ll take them all.

Make and Model
Some makes and models have parts or materials that hold more value in the recycling market. These differences can affect your payout and help determine the best possible offer.

Year of Manufacture
The year of your vehicle helps us estimate both metal value and parts potential. Older cars are priced mainly for weight, while newer models may include components worth salvaging.

Market Metal Prices
Scrap metal values rise and fall with market demand. We update our offers regularly to reflect current pricing trends. We ensure that every quote we offer is fair and competitive.

Vehicle Size & Weight
Larger vehicles like vans, SUVs, and trucks contain more recyclable material. That extra weight often translates into higher payouts compared to smaller cars.

Driveability
Even if your car doesn’t run, we’ll still take it. Vehicles that can move on their own are sometimes easier to load, which can slightly increase your final offer

Why It Matters When You Scrap Your Car
- Studies estimate that around 94% of end-of-life vehicles (ELVs) in Ontario are collected for recycling.
- About 83% of each vehicle’s weight can be reused or recycled when processed correctly.
- Retired vehicles often contain 40 litres or more of fluids, including oil, coolant, and fuel, which must be drained safely to protect the environment.
Our Process at Our Auto Salvage Yard
When you sell your car to a breaker’s yard like ours, it’s handled by experienced auto wreckers who follow strict environmental standards. Every vehicle is logged and prepared for safe dismantling. We drain and store all fluids, including oil, fuel, and coolant, and remove reusable parts such as batteries, engines, and catalytic converters. Usable components are restored for resale, while non-working vehicles are processed by our licensed car scrappers on-site. The metal shell is compacted, shredded, and sorted for recycling, ensuring that valuable materials are recovered and waste is minimized.

To scrap your car in Ontario legally, you’ll need to gather several key documents. Providing these ensures the transaction goes smoothly and protects you from future liability.
Vehicle Ownership (Green Permit) – This is the green ownership slip issued by the Ministry of Transportation of Ontario (MTO). On the back, you’ll find the “Application for Transfer” section, which must be completed by the seller (you) and, in most cases, the licensed recycler (buyer).
Government-issued ID – A valid driver’s licence or passport to confirm your identity and match the name on the ownership document.
License Plates – Remove your license plates before vehicle pickup and return them to a ServiceOntario location or follow their instructions. This step deregisters the plates and can protect you from future plate misuse.
Bill of Sale/Receipt (optional but strongly recommended) – While not always required for scrapping, getting a receipt or bill of sale from the recycler helps document the transaction for your records.
Clearance of Liens or Outstanding Fees – Although scrapping bypasses re-registration, you should still check that there are no outstanding liens or plate fees attached to the vehicle.
Once these are ready, the licensed scrap yard will complete the transfer, update the vehicle’s status with the MTO, and you’re released from ownership.
If you’ve lost the ownership slip (the green permit) or it’s missing, scrapping becomes more complex, but it’s not always impossible.
Lack of ownership papers means the recycler cannot legally accept the vehicle until ownership is confirmed. The MTO treats scrapping as a form of sale/disposal, so the legal right to dispose of the vehicle must be proven.
Options include requesting a replacement ownership permit from ServiceOntario. You’ll typically need to provide the VIN, your ID, and possibly proof of address. Once the permit is replaced, you can proceed. In some situations (inherited vehicles, abandoned vehicles on your property, gifted vehicles), you may need additional documents like a bill of sale, an executor’s affidavit, or a transfer form to establish your legal right to scrap it.
If you attempt to scrap without proper proof of ownership, you risk legal issues, delayed pickup, or reduced quotes, because no recycler wants to accept a vehicle they cannot legally own.

Yes, you can absolutely scrap a car without wheels, and we accept vehicles missing wheels, tires, or even engines.
Vehicles missing wheels are still valuable because much of their value is in the metal weight, other parts, and salvageable components like catalytic converters or transmissions. For us, the process is the same: we provide you with a quote and arrange pickup. We have the equipment to load non-running, stripped, or disabled vehicles.
Before pickup, you still need to remove any personal items and license plates. But you don’t need to worry if the car is incomplete or lacks wheels. We’ll still take it. Because missing wheels can increase towing complexity or time, make sure to inform us at the quote stage so we can send the right equipment and keep your experience smooth-sailing.
In short, missing wheels don’t disqualify your vehicle. We’ll still pay and handle removal. Many people bring in “shell” cars and still receive a payout.

Transferring ownership is a key legal step in scrapping your vehicle in Ontario. Doing it properly ensures you’re no longer responsible for the vehicle. Here’s the step-by-step:
On the vehicle ownership permit (green slip), complete the “Application for Transfer” on the back. As the seller, you fill in your name, address, current mileage, and sign the seller portion. The buyer (licensed recycler) fills in their portion.
Remove your licence plates from the vehicle prior to handing it over, and either return them to ServiceOntario or transfer them to another vehicle if you intend to keep the plates.
Hand the vehicle, signed ownership permit, and any additional required ID/documents to the scrap yard. They will submit the transfer to the MTO, mark the vehicle as “scrapped” or “deregistered,” and issue you a receipt or bill of sale.
Keep copies or photos of the receipt, transfer documents, and scrap yard certificate for your records. This protects you from future liability if, for example, the vehicle is used illegally or incurs fines after it’s gone.
If your vehicle had outstanding tolls, fines, or plate renewal fees, check them before pickup. Those must be cleared or disclosed, as some yards will deduct or refuse collection if major unpaid issues exist.

Before handing your vehicle over for scrapping, it’s wise to remove all items of personal value and anything you might need later. Items to remove include:
Personal belongings from the glove box, door pockets, under seats, trunk compartments
Toll transponders, parking passes, garage door openers, or other devices linked to you
After-market audio gear, roof racks, bicycles, or personal accessories, if you want to keep them
License plates (see next FAQ)
By preparing these items ahead of time, you avoid losing something important and ensure the process goes smoothly when the tow truck arrives.
In Ontario, your license plates remain registered to you, not the vehicle, so you should remove them before the car is picked up. After removal, you have two main options:
Return the plates to a ServiceOntario location. You may receive credit for the unused portion, which you can apply to future vehicle registration.
Transfer the plates to another vehicle you own, if applicable. In this case, keep the plate portion of the ownership slip and ensure the new vehicle is properly registered.
Yes, it’s important to notify your insurance provider once the vehicle is scrapped or about to be removed. While you may not need to “cancel” the policy immediately, you should inform them that the vehicle will be off the road and transferred to a licensed recycler. This prevents you from continuing to pay premiums on a vehicle you no longer own or use. After pickup and ownership transfer, you should also ensure the vehicle is deregistered with the Ontario Ministry of Transportation (MTO) so you’re no longer responsible for plate renewal, parking fines, or other liabilities.
The cash payout for scrapping a car in Toronto varies widely because many factors influence the final offer. According to recent industry sources:
Typical small cars may fetch $100-$400 in weight-only value if many parts are missing.
Mid-sized sedans in fair condition with usable components might get $250-$800 or more.
Larger vehicles, trucks, vans, or makes with valuable parts sometimes reach over $1,000, depending on the metal market, condition, and parts like catalytic converters.
